Isha Talwar, who began her career with Telugu films like Nithiin’s Gunde Jaari Gallanthayyinde and Raja Cheyyi Vesthe, has now become a prominent name in the OTT space.
After a brief phase in Telugu cinema, she moved to Malayalam films and later found her place in Hindi web series and dramas.
Recently she completed 13 years in the industry and said about a disturbing experience from her early days.
She recalled that during an audition Bollywood casting director Shanoo Sharma asked to perform a crying scene in the middle of a crowded restaurant with assistants watching.
Isha described it as a confusing and uncomfortable request that shook her confidence as a newcomer. She stressed that auditions should be held in proper casting spaces or rented locations for realism.
